(ANSA) - TOKYO, 12 FEB - The Tokyo Stock Exchange starts trading in the name of caution after yesterday's day of public holidays, on fears of an overheating of global stock markets following the tracing underway on WallStreet.

At the opening, the Nikkei recorded a slightly positive change of 0.23% at 29,405.97, adding 67 points.


   On the foreign exchange market, the yen trades at 104.70 against the dollar and just above 127 against the euro.
